About Agriculture Law in Tomar, Portugal

Agriculture is a vital part of the economy in Tomar, Portugal, with many individuals and businesses relying on the industry for their livelihood. As such, there are specific laws and regulations in place to govern agriculture practices in the region.

Why You May Need a Lawyer

There are several situations where individuals may require legal help in the field of agriculture in Tomar, Portugal. Some common reasons include disputes over land ownership, contract disagreements with suppliers or buyers, regulatory compliance issues, and environmental concerns.

Local Laws Overview

In Tomar, Portugal, agriculture is regulated by both national and regional laws. Some key aspects of local laws that are particularly relevant to agriculture include land use regulations, water rights, pesticide usage, and animal welfare standards.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. Can I be held liable for environmental damage caused by my farming activities?

Yes, you can be held liable for environmental damage caused by your farming activities. It is important to follow all environmental regulations and take measures to prevent harm to the environment.

2. What are my rights as a landowner in Tomar, Portugal?

As a landowner in Tomar, Portugal, you have the right to use your land for agricultural purposes within the boundaries of the law. It is important to understand your rights and responsibilities as a landowner.

3. Are there any subsidies available for farmers in Tomar, Portugal?

Yes, there are subsidies available for farmers in Tomar, Portugal. These subsidies are designed to support agricultural activities and encourage sustainable practices.

4. What should I do if I have a dispute with a supplier or buyer?

If you have a dispute with a supplier or buyer, it is important to seek legal advice. A lawyer can help you navigate the situation and protect your rights.

5. How can I ensure that my farming practices are in compliance with local laws?

To ensure that your farming practices are in compliance with local laws, it is important to stay informed about current regulations and seek guidance from legal professionals when needed.

6. Can I challenge a decision made by a regulatory agency regarding my farming operation?

Yes, you can challenge a decision made by a regulatory agency regarding your farming operation. It is important to follow the proper procedures for challenging regulatory decisions and seek legal assistance if necessary.

7. What are the steps involved in purchasing agricultural land in Tomar, Portugal?

The steps involved in purchasing agricultural land in Tomar, Portugal may vary, but typically include conducting due diligence, negotiating the terms of the sale, and completing the legal formalities required for the transfer of ownership.

8. Are there any restrictions on the use of pesticides in agriculture in Tomar, Portugal?

Yes, there are restrictions on the use of pesticides in agriculture in Tomar, Portugal. It is important to follow all regulations related to pesticide usage to protect the environment and public health.

9. How can I protect my intellectual property rights in relation to my agricultural products?

To protect your intellectual property rights in relation to your agricultural products, you may consider obtaining patents or trademarks for unique inventions or branding. It is important to seek legal advice to understand your options.

10. What should I do if I suspect animal cruelty on a neighboring farm?

If you suspect animal cruelty on a neighboring farm, you should report your concerns to the appropriate authorities. Animal welfare laws are in place to protect animals from harm, and it is important to take action if you believe these laws are being violated.
